What are the most common types of addiction treatment programs available in Middletown, CT, and how do they differ?

In Middletown, CT, you can find a range of programs including outpatient services, intensive outpatient programs (IOP), and partial hospitalization programs (PHP). Local centers like Rushford and Middlesex Hospital's Behavioral Health often offer these, with outpatient being flexible for those with work or family commitments, while IOP and PHP provide more structured, frequent care without full residential stays. Some facilities also integrate medication-assisted treatment (MAT) for opioid or alcohol addiction.

How can I verify if a rehab center in Middletown, CT, accepts my insurance or offers financial assistance?

To verify insurance acceptance, contact Middletown-based centers like Rushford or Community Health Center directly, as they often work with major insurers like Anthem, ConnectiCare, and Medicaid. Additionally, you can check with your insurance provider or explore local state-funded options through the Connecticut Department of Mental Health and Addiction Services (DMHAS), which may offer sliding-scale fees or grants for residents in need.

Are there specialized addiction treatment programs in Middletown, CT, for specific groups like veterans, LGBTQ+ individuals, or young adults?

Yes, Middletown has specialized programs catering to diverse groups; for example, Rushford offers tailored services for young adults and may provide culturally competent care. While not all centers have dedicated LGBTQ+ or veteran programs, local resources like the Middlesex County Substance Abuse Action Council can connect individuals to inclusive providers or refer them to nearby cities like Hartford for more specialized support.

What local support resources are available in Middletown, CT, for ongoing recovery after completing a rehab program?

After rehab, Middletown residents can access ongoing support through local 12-step meetings (e.g., AA or NA groups at churches like First Church of Christ), sober living homes, and outpatient follow-up at centers like Rushford. The city also has community organizations such as the Middlesex County Recovery Council, which offers peer support and recovery coaching to help maintain sobriety in daily life.

How do I choose between inpatient and outpatient rehab options in Middletown, CT, based on my specific situation?

Choosing between inpatient and outpatient in Middletown depends on factors like addiction severity, home environment, and daily responsibilities; inpatient (residential) programs are less common locally but available through referrals to nearby facilities, while outpatient options at places like Rushford are prevalent for mild to moderate cases. Consulting with a local addiction specialist or your primary care doctor at Middlesex Hospital can help assess your needs and recommend the best fit, considering Middletown's accessible outpatient network.

Understanding what 'rehab near me' truly means is essential. Rehabilitation is not a one-size-fits-all process; it encompasses various levels of care tailored to individual needs. In the Middletown area, you can find outpatient programs that allow you to receive therapy and support while maintaining daily responsibilities, as well as more intensive options like partial hospitalization or residential treatment facilities located within a short drive. The Connecticut Department of Mental Health and Addiction Services (DMHAS) is a vital state resource, and local agencies often collaborate with providers to ensure comprehensive care. Seeking treatment close to home in Middletown can provide the stability of familiar surroundings and the support of your personal network, which can be incredibly beneficial during early recovery.

When looking for a rehab center, consider key factors such as the types of addiction treated, the therapies offered, and whether the program accepts your insurance. Many facilities in Connecticut, including those serving Middletown residents, utilize evidence-based approaches like cognitive-behavioral therapy, medication-assisted treatment, and holistic wellness practices. It is highly recommended to verify credentials and read reviews, but also to trust your instincts during consultations. The right program should make you feel respected, understood, and hopeful. Remember, the goal is to find a place where you can build a solid foundation for long-term recovery.

Taking the first step can feel overwhelming, but support is readily available. You can start by speaking confidentially with your primary care physician in Middletown, who can provide referrals. The national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A) helpline at 1-800-662-HELP is a free, 24/7 service that can connect you to local treatment options. Additionally, community organizations and support groups in Middletown, such as those hosting AA or NA meetings, offer immediate peer support and can be a source of personal recommendations.
